Aldi are selling cat collars impregnated with permethrin, which is known to be highly toxic to cats
They are marketed as Beaphar Soft Cat Flea Collars
I have brought this to the attention of my local Aldi manager who said he would take it up with their Head Office
Hopefully they will remove them from sale
MEANWHILE DO NOT BUY ONE OF THESE COLLARS

From what I have read most cat flea collars contain permethrin, but at a level that is only harmful if it is added to other exposure. It still seems an unnecessary risk, though.
